Event description

Employee killed when crushed by collapsing crane boom

Investigation abstract

On June 21, 1986, Employee #1 was assisting a coworker in dismantling the boom s ection of a truck crane. The crane boom had not been secured with cribbing or bl ocking. Employee #1 removed the lower boom pins while he was under the boom sect ion. The boom fell on top of him, causing massive head injures. Employee #1 was killed.
